Built In Furniture Construction in Greensboro, NC
Built-in furniture construction services involve creating custom storage solutions that are seamlessly integrated into a property's existing architecture. This includes built-in shelves, wall units, cabinets, entertainment centers, and other fixtures designed to maximize space and enhance the aesthetic appeal of living areas, bedrooms, kitchens, or offices. Property owners typically seek these services when aiming to improve organization, optimize space, or achieve a cohesive interior design. Before requesting built-in furniture construction, it’s helpful to consider the specific dimensions, style preferences, and functionality desired, as well as any existing architectural features that might influence the design.
Homeowners and property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including material options, installation requirements, and how the built-ins will complement the existing decor. Clarifying the intended use of the space, budget considerations, and the timeline for completion can also aid in planning. Proper planning ensures that the final result aligns with personal needs and aesthetic goals, making built-in furniture a practical and stylish addition to any property.

Common Built In Furniture Construction Jobs
Built-in closet systems - custom storage solutions designed to maximize space and organization.
Kitchen cabinetry - tailored built-in cabinets that enhance functionality and style in the kitchen.
Entertainment centers - integrated furniture for media equipment that blends seamlessly with home decor.
Built-in shelving units - practical storage options that optimize wall space in living areas or bedrooms.
Bathroom vanities - custom fixtures that provide efficient storage and a polished look.
Office built-ins - functional furniture designed to create productive and clutter-free workspaces.
Built In Furniture Construction Questions
What types of built-in furniture projects are common? Typical projects include custom bookcases, kitchen cabinets, closet systems, and entertainment centers tailored to specific spaces.
Can built-in furniture be integrated into existing rooms? Yes, built-in pieces are designed to seamlessly fit into existing walls and room layouts for a cohesive look.
What materials are used for built-in furniture? Common materials include hardwoods, plywood, and MDF, selected based on durability and desired finish.
Is built-in furniture suitable for small or awkward spaces? Built-in options are often ideal for maximizing storage and functionality in tight or irregularly shaped areas.
